Deep laterally compressed bodies are generally silvery or golden in color, with a short adipose fin, jaws with a single row of sharp tricuspid sheering teeth and no molars
Other characids look somewhat similar but can be distinguished primarily by the dentition. There are several dozen species of piranha Piranhas are freshwater fish found in south america. Fishermen often catch them for food or trade, and some communities even engage in piranha fishing tourism
While piranhas can be dangerous, attacks are rare and usually provoked.
